Bexar County Commissioner Tommy Calvert’s vision for 51 acres next to JBSA-Randolph — which includes palm-tree-lined streets connecting county buildings with hotels and shopping centers — is moving forward.shows a richly landscaped development with an open-air market, shops, fountains and green spaces.

Calvert said he asked for the additional money because the project’s designers hadn’t met with the construction manager until two weeks ago. The contract didn’t include bullet-resistant features and an outdoor trellis clad with polished stainless steel. But Dan Curry, county facilities management director, said they’d taken into account ballistic fabrics, the trellis and landscaping.

“We, as staff, would not recommend adding $1.3 million to clad the trellis in polished stainless steel fabric,” Curry said. “We think it brings no value to the job.” To fund the additional $900,000, the county transferred money from about a dozen small capital projects from past budgets that are completed or inactive, County Manager David Smith told commissioners. Commissioner Rebeca Clay-Flores asked if the redirected funds might affect her precinct. Smith said no.At Rocket Lane and Loop 1604 in Converse next to Joint Base San Antonio-Randolph, the building is set for completion in the summer of 2024.
